ingredients
- 3⁄4 cup flour
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1⁄2 teaspoon salt
- 3 tablespoons margarine
- 1 egg
- 1 package vanilla pudding mix (not instant)
- 1⁄2 cup milk
- 1 (20 ounce) can peaches (drained)
- 8 ounces cream cheese
- 1⁄2 cup sugar
- 3 tablespoons peach juice
- 1 tablespoon sugar
- 1⁄2 teaspoon cinnamon
directions
- Mix first 7 ingredients and pour into 9 inch square pan.
- Drain peaches and arrange on top of batter.
- Save some of the juice.
- Mix the cream cheese, 1/2 cup sugar and 3 tbls peach juice and pour over the peaches.
- Sprinkle the top with 1 tbls sugar mixed with 1/2 tsp cinnamon.
- Bake 35 minutes in 350 degree oven.
